Monday
So far, things are not going according to plan at all. I should be a bit worked up over this, but I'm not worked up at all. In fact, it's kind of stimulating in an odd sense.

I wanted to finish my novel for NaNo today. The plan was to write another chapter on Saturday, one on Sunday, and then the final today. Unless of course things were running too long and another chapter was needed, then it was two for today, or one today and another tomorrow, to finish the novel. I'm off work today and tomorrow, so it should have worked great; or at least it did in the planning stage.

Reality is always so much more down to earth and unpredictable, however. So, Saturday I did my chapter, passed fifty thousand, and I was pumped to finish. Of course, I'm still excited by my accomplishment of doing over fifty thousand words for NaNo and not in a month, but in half that time. No preparations except a story idea the day before it kicked off. My first writing for NaNo was the outline. To add to this, I also took a couple of days off, one the first week, and one the second week, so I wrote the total in fourteen days.

But, like I said, I still have a few, two or three chapters to write to finish the story. I'm thinking of about sixty thousand by the end, roughly. Saturday went well, but Sunday I got home later, as is normal, and just could not get anything to go. So, I decided it must be time for another day off. No big deal, since I had Monday and Tuesday off and could make up for the day off easy enough.

In fact, I kind of enjoyed taking that break and went to bed eager to get up and get going. I had plans for a nice start after sleeping in a little, enjoying some coffee and a nice breakfast with my wife, then doing our Bible study. But, I slept later than I intended, I had a terrible backache and stiff neck. I'll add here past injuries are a real pain; pun intended. Then upon getting up, my foot hurt, my other leg was stiff, and I felt terrible. I suppose the effects of my flu shot. Most of it passed, but the stiff neck didn't let up, nor did the throbbing pain in my lower back.

Rhonda does magic with her fingers and soon had some knots worked out and the back feeling better, but the neck was stubborn. I ended up with a very intense headache to go with it, and was just unable to do much of anything most of the day. By mid afternoon, the neck finally started to loosen up, but the headache is still present. I took some over the counter medication to lessen it, and it's helped, but it's still present.

So, no writing today. I can't really call upon the imagination when it's being blocked by pain. Even so, we made a trip into town, got some brandy to sip on tonight, we are having a wonderful dinner, and I'm enjoying another day off with my love. Tomorrow I'll have to write like a madman, but if I don't get it all done tomorrow, I will soon.

So, let's see where tomorrow puts us.
